TICKET GK-4471: Config drift on TurnTally counter nodes. Gates 3 and 7 at Ferndale Arena report counts with a different debounce window than the fleet baseline, inflating entry totals. Someone hand-edited the node configs after the Copperfield match; changes never landed in the repo. Security impact: tamper detection relies on count consistency. Need review before we reconcile. The baseline values we intend to enforce follow.

config for kafof-bawef:
holath:
  log_level: debug
  metrics_host: metrics.holath.qorvelsys.internal
  pin: 2191
  pool_size: 32

Q: Why is the Fernwick autocomplete index slow after deploys? A: The Siltbrook shard rebuilds its trigram tables on cold start, which can take ten minutes. This is expected, not a breach indicator. To inspect the sealed rebuild logs, unlock the audit vault with the recovery passphrase below.

vault phrase of bajof-tafop = alddor-zordor-holiel-briix-tamath-fraath-ulavan-rusix-kelox-ulair

### Step 4: Point support tooling at the new user service

The user module has been split out of the Ordano monolith into a standalone service called Persona. Account lookups, password resets, and profile edits now go through Persona's admin panel; the legacy screens are read-only until decommissioning. Support tickets opened against the old module will be auto-routed. Before handling live cases, verify the tooling is using the service configuration values listed below.

settings of fadup-kajog:
[casox]
port = 3000
team = jorix
host = casox.paliqio.example
region = lower-4
access_code = ac_dd069a
timeout_ms = 750

## Building Access — Training Video Studio

The recording studio on Level 2 of Thistleworth House is a controlled space. Facilities staff should enter only when the red "recording" lamp is off, as sound spill ruins takes. Cleaning is scheduled Tuesdays before 08:00; equipment must not be unplugged or repositioned. All entries are logged automatically at the door reader. Access for maintenance visits requires the code below.

staff pass of kawip-hawef = bdg-QLP-2